Excel如何快速返回对应值?如何实现精准匹配查询?
作者:佚名|分类:EXCEL|浏览:94|发布时间:2025-03-18 11:46:02
Excel如何快速返回对应值?如何实现精准匹配查询?
导语:
Excel作为一款强大的数据处理工具,广泛应用于各种办公场景。在处理大量数据时,快速准确地找到所需信息是提高工作效率的关键。本文将详细介绍如何在Excel中快速返回对应值,并实现精准匹配查询。
一、Excel快速返回对应值的方法
1. 使用VLOOKUP函数
VLOOKUP函数是Excel中常用的查找函数之一,可以快速返回对应值。其语法格式如下:
VLOOKUP(查找值,查找范围,返回列数,精确匹配/近似匹配)
查找值:要查找的值。
查找范围:包含查找值和对应值的范围。
返回列数:返回查找值所在列的下一列的值。
精确匹配/近似匹配:选择“精确匹配”或“近似匹配”。
例如,假设我们有一个包含姓名和成绩的表格,现在要查找张三的成绩,可以使用以下公式:
=VLOOKUP("张三", A2:B10, 2, FALSE)
2. 使用INDEX和MATCH函数
INDEX和MATCH函数组合使用可以实现类似VLOOKUP的效果,但更加灵活。其语法格式如下:
INDEX(数组,行号,列号)
MATCH(查找值,查找范围,匹配类型)
数组:要查找的数组。
行号:返回数组中对应行的值。
列号:返回数组中对应列的值。
查找值:要查找的值。
查找范围:包含查找值和对应值的范围。
匹配类型:选择“0”(精确匹配)或“1”(近似匹配)。
例如,假设我们有一个包含姓名和成绩的表格,现在要查找张三的成绩,可以使用以下公式:
=INDEX(A2:B10, MATCH("张三", A2:A10, 0), 2)
3. 使用HLOOKUP函数
HLOOKUP函数与VLOOKUP类似,用于在表格的顶部查找值。其语法格式如下:
HLOOKUP(查找值,查找范围,返回列数,精确匹配/近似匹配)
查找值:要查找的值。
查找范围:包含查找值和对应值的范围。
返回列数:返回查找值所在列的下一列的值。
精确匹配/近似匹配:选择“精确匹配”或“近似匹配”。
例如,假设我们有一个包含姓名和成绩的表格,现在要查找李四的成绩,可以使用以下公式:
=HLOOKUP("李四", A2:B10, 2, FALSE)
二、实现精准匹配查询的方法
1. 使用IF函数
IF函数可以根据条件判断返回两个值之一。其语法格式如下:
IF(条件,值1,值2)
条件:判断条件是否成立。
值1:条件成立时返回的值。
值2:条件不成立时返回的值。
例如,假设我们有一个包含姓名和成绩的表格,现在要判断张三的成绩是否大于80分,可以使用以下公式:
=IF(A2="张三" AND B2>80, "是", "否")
2. 使用COUNTIF函数
COUNTIF函数可以统计满足特定条件的单元格数量。其语法格式如下:
COUNTIF(条件区域,条件)
条件区域:包含条件的区域。
条件:要统计的特定条件。
例如,假设我们有一个包含姓名和成绩的表格,现在要统计成绩大于80分的人数,可以使用以下公式:
=COUNTIF(B2:B10, ">80")
3. 使用SUMIF函数
SUMIF函数可以对满足特定条件的单元格求和。其语法格式如下:
SUMIF(条件区域,条件,求和区域)
条件区域:包含条件的区域。
条件:要统计的特定条件。
求和区域:要计算的单元格区域。
例如,假设我们有一个包含姓名和成绩的表格,现在要计算成绩大于80分的学生总成绩,可以使用以下公式:
=SUMIF(B2:B10, ">80", C2:C10)
三、相关问答
1. 问题:VLOOKUP函数和INDEX和MATCH函数有什么区别?
答案:VLOOKUP函数和INDEX和MATCH函数都可以实现查找对应值的功能,但INDEX和MATCH函数更加灵活,可以返回任意列的值。
2. 问题:如何使用HLOOKUP函数查找表格中的数据?
答案:HLOOKUP函数的语法格式为HLOOKUP(查找值,查找范围,返回列数,精确匹配/近似匹配),其中查找值是要查找的值,查找范围是包含查找值和对应值的范围,返回列数是返回查找值所在列的下一列的值。
3. 问题:如何使用IF函数实现条件判断?
答案:IF函数的语法格式为IF(条件,值1,值2),其中条件是判断条件是否成立,值1是条件成立时返回的值,值2是条件不成立时返回的值。
4. 问题:如何使用COUNTIF函数统计满足特定条件的单元格数量?
答案:COUNTIF函数的语法格式为COUNTIF(条件区域,条件),其中条件区域是包含条件的区域,条件是要统计的特定条件。
总结:
在Excel中,我们可以通过多种方法实现快速返回对应值和精准匹配查询。掌握这些方法,可以大大提高我们的数据处理效率。在实际应用中,可以根据具体需求选择合适的方法,以达到最佳效果。